The MJ story is half right. Michael Jackson was originally going to work on the soundtrack, but he pulled out after it became apparent it would need to be an FM rather than a (Sega) CD based soundtrack.
MJ's writing partner at the time, a chap named Brad Buxor, did provide some music for the game however, which is why some of the instrumental parts from Sonic 3 found their way into tracks on Dangerous. GameTrailers did a rather extensive episode of PopFiction about the whole thing that's worth watching if you haven't already. IIRC, It seemed to me that there really is no consensus as to whether he was dropped due to the accusations or whether he left voluntarily because he didn't care for the sound quality coming out of the Genesis. Different people seemed to remember different things. It's possible that there are grains of truth in all of it. But what isn't in dispute is that he did in fact, work on Sonic 3 in some capacity. And at least some of those tracks were definitely put into the final game.
